MarketAxess (NASDAQ:MKTX – Get Free Report) announ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The financial services provider reported $1.95 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.86 by $0.09, FiscalAI reports. MarketAxess had a return on equity of 22.28% and a net margin of 35.53%.During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$2.00 earnings per share. The business’s quarterly revenue was down .5% on a year-over-year basis.

MarketAxess News Summary
Here are the key news stories impacting MarketAxess this week:
- Positive Sentiment: Intercontinental Exchange agreed to acquire MarketAxess for $167 per share in cash. The transaction values MarketAxess at roughly $6 billion and is expected to create a broader fixed-income marketplace. ICE to Acquire MarketAxess
- Positive Sentiment: The proposed cash consideration represents a substantial premium to MarketAxess’ recent trading levels, explaining the strong investor response. The transaction remains subject to customary closing conditions and approvals. Intercontinental Exchange to Buy MarketAxess
- Positive Sentiment: MarketAxess reported second-quarter earnings of $1.95 per share, exceeding analyst estimates of approximately $1.86–$1.88. MarketAxess Q2 Earnings Beat Estimates
- Neutral Sentiment: Quarterly revenue was $218.4 million, roughly flat year over year, while total commission revenue declined 3% to $186.9 million. EPS also decreased from $2.00 a year earlier, showing that the standalone operating results were mixed. MarketAxess Second-Quarter Results
- Negative Sentiment: Several law firms announced investigations into whether MarketAxess directors obtained a fair price and complied with fiduciary duties in the ICE transaction. These announcements could create execution risk or pressure for improved deal terms, although they have not changed the proposed $167 consideration. Ademi MarketAxess Investigation

About MarketAxess
MarketAxess Holdings Inc operates a leading global electronic trading platform specializing in fixed-income securities and related products. The company’s network enables institutional investors and broker-dealers to trade corporate bonds, municipal securities, emerging markets debt, U.S. Treasuries and credit default swaps in an automated, multi-dealer environment. MarketAxess also offers portfolio trading, data analytics, best-execution tools and post-trade services to streamline workflows and enhance price discovery across its marketplace.
In addition to core voice-like trading protocols, MarketAxess provides Open Trading®, an anonymous, all-to-all trading protocol designed to improve liquidity and transaction efficiency.
